Context - So I came back to work at the end of August. Busy, public sector. I was acting up on a higher position but they have been reduced and I’m waiting to find out today whether il keep acting up or going back down to my substantive post. I’m genuinely fine either way as the other candidates for the higher post are exceptional so no hard feelings at all.

While I was on leave my manager moved on to a different sector and another manager made a horizontal move to be my manager. I know them, good relationship and so had no worries about coming back.

But since coming back I feel like I’m being ghosted like a bad tinder date! I get I’m in between roles and not my new managers priority right now. I would be happy with a quick email once a week just checking in that I’m ok and got things to do.

But Instead I get

  • run around re the Rota to go in the office. Literally no will take ownership for getting me on it which means I’m always at home. They all want to be in the office.
  • I have emailed my manager and colleagues for work. Nothing. For the first few days I took initiative and found things to do but it’s getting past a joke now.
  • they forget to invite me to team meetings, when they do literally no one acknowledged I was back.
  • i was asked by colleagues whether I have thought if it is time to move and thinking about working in a different (geographical area). Me stepping down effects them so part of me understands they want me to piss off but it was upsetting for them to blatantly suggest I leave.
I don’t expect banners, I don’t need a lot of attention and I get that things have moved on and their priority is keeping the business on the ground moving.

So basically I’m at home, with my laptop and I hear from virtually no one.

I feel so tearful. I’m mad at myself for caring because I’m pretty good at being independent but I realised today that I could have disappeared for 12 days before my manager would notice - the time inbetween any contact.

Aibu unreasonable for being upset by this or am I being precious? I can take the truth but please go a little softer on me as I really am feeling shitty. Thanks guys!
